If you love the rich, earthy flavor of truffle but want something quick and easy, this Truffle Mushroom Pasta is perfect! Using bottled truffle sauce, you can whip up a restaurant-quality dish in just 20 minutes! No fancy ingredients or techniques needed.
Ingredients (Serves 2-3)
200g pasta of choice (I use vegeroni spirals for a healthier choice!)
200g button mushrooms, sliced
2 tbsp butter
2 cloves garlic, minced
2 tbsp bottled truffle sauce (adjust to taste)
Salt & black pepper, to taste
1 tbsp olive oil
1 tsp truffle oil
Method
1. Cook the Pasta
• Boil a pot of salted water and cook the pasta according to package instructions.
• Reserve ½ cup of pasta water, then drain and set aside.
2. Saute the Mushrooms
• Heat olive oil and butter in a pan over medium heat.
•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ant.
• Toss in sliced mushrooms and saute for 4-5 minutes until soft and lightly browned.
• Season with salt and black pepper.
3. Make the Truffle Sauce
• Lower the heat and stir in the bottled truffle sauce.
• If the sauce is too thick, add a splash of reserved pasta water.
4. Combine Everything
• Toss in the cooked pasta and mix well to coat evenly in the sauce.
• Drizzle with truffle oil for an extra boost of flavour.
5. Serve & Enjoy
• Serve immediately and enjoy the creamy, truffle-infused goodness!
